Why the constant updating of the Program?


Recommended Posts

This is the only program I have ever owned that wants me to update it almost every two weeks.

I am used to security programs updating their definitions all the time, but updating the program itself, so often, seems either over-professional or non-professional. It is almost as though the engineers are never satisfied with their code. Does anyone know why this is the only program I have that wants to update itself constantly? Or more direct;  Why is Piriform updating the "program" so often?

other than hotfixes to repair system killing bugs, ccleaner is released once a month, not two weeks. These monthly releases add programs to be detected and fixes for bugs.

Some of the changes are without a doubt marketing. But they've also introduced bugs with all the additions they keep making. Usually a new version is released about once per month, however if there's a bad enough bug they do sometimes push a new version out quicker which is no different than allot of other software.
